How Much Do You or Should You Spend on a Fabulous Wedding Cake?

By Crissy

For many couples, the cost of a wedding cake is a crucial consideration. Wedding cakes are one of the most expensive items at a wedding reception, and they add up quickly. There are a few ways to save money on your cake. Finding a reputable wedding cake cost consultant is one of them. Wedding planners can provide useful advice on how to keep the cost of the wedding cake as low as feasible. You might want to explore at wedding cake cost estimator tools as well.

The average U.S. wedding cake cost is around $ 350, according to Thumbtacks, an on-line service that matches clients with local professionals. On the low end, couples typically pay around $ 125 and on the high end, they usually pay up to $ 700!
